Method for checking cross-sensitivity of ammonia of nitrogen oxide sensor in SCR catalyst system of diesel engine, involves determining nitrogen oxide concentration in exhaust gas between catalysts from nitrogen oxide model
The method involves constructing a model of nitrogen oxide concentration in exhaust gas between catalysts (13, 21). An ammonia slip model of the catalyst is constructed. Operability of nitrogen oxide sensors (41, 44, 46) is checked by verifying a sensor signal with ammonia concentration in the exhaust gas between the catalysts that are determined by the ammonia slip model. Nitrogen oxide concentration in the exhaust gas between the catalysts is determined from the nitrogen oxide model. An independent claim is also included for a computer program comprising a set of instructions to perform a method for checking cross-sensitivity of ammonia of a nitrogen oxide sensor in a catalyst system.
